SAN DIEGO-Alexandria Real Estate Equities, Inc., in conjunction with Illumina, Inc., a world-leader in genetic sequencing, have completed Illumina's global headquarters in San Diego.  The project comprises an approximately-497,000-rentable-square-foot life science campus with additional onsite ground-up development opportunities aggregating approximately 393,000-rentable-square-feet.

An event was held last week, and company executives expected to be joined by special guest State Senator Marty Block to mark the completion of the campus, a world-class laboratory/office facility, a fitness facility and 1,750 seat outdoor amphitheater.

“Illumina worked closely with Alexandria to design our global headquarters with collaborative open spaces throughout the campus to foster continuous innovation and teamwork,” said Illumina's president and CEO Jay Flatley. “Our culture and campus environment are key to fostering our continued growth, helping us attract and retain top talent.”

Illumina is the global leader in genetic sequencing and analysis technologies and services, with a mission of unlocking the power of the genome to improve human health. The company employs approximately 1,300 individuals locally, with significant hiring plans for San Diego in 2013. Illumina's headquarters campus, developed and owned by Alexandria, is helping the company to increase employee productivity and efficiencies, and to operate in an open, collaborative campus environment.

“The Illumina campus is one of, if not, the premier life science campus in San Diego's thriving life science community,” said Daniel Ryan, EVP and regional market director at Alexandria Real Estate Equities, Inc. “Alexandria has been proud to work with Illumina to develop a one-of-a-kind campus that suits the Company's unique corporate culture, and features state-of-the-art laboratory/office spaces, as well as highly innovative and collaborative amenities.”

Illumina represents the latest addition to Alexandria's largest and leading San Diego asset base, which is comprised of approximately 2.6 million-rentable-square-feet of the highest quality and most innovative life science campuses and facilities in the region. The Illumina campus has numerous amenities designed to promote employee health and well-being, including a gym and athletic facilities, as well as dedicated areas that promote Illumina's values of collaboration and openness, such as a unique outdoor amphitheater, team-oriented work spaces, and a full-service café.
